Most guidebooks emphasize there isn't much of anything to do in Chiclayo. It's a very usefull city, and that's it. Still, the Plaza de Armas is a nice place, although it lacks colonial splendour. The Mercado Modelo and the market area in general are nice places to hang around. If you arrive here from the middle of the jungle it's paradise though: supermarkets, shops, even a cinema!
The most important museum of Chiclayo isn't even in Chiclayo but in Lambayeque. Other atractions of the city are it's beaches.

Bruning Museum
Edit ThisIt's so ugly you just have to take a picture
photo by: joosts
In nearby Lambayeque. Great collection of pre-colombian artifacts from the Pyramids of Sipan.
You can get there with a minibus for one sol.
